An African ethnomedicine shows potential in treating hypertension
Hypertension is a dangerous condition that leads to a wide variety of complications. A study published in the journal BMC Complementary and Alternative Medicine looked into the diuretic and antioxidant properties of Vepris heterophylla, a plant native to Africa, and its potential role as a natural treatment for high blood pressure. The diuretic potential of the Vepris heterophylla
Vepris heterophylla, a plant used in African ethnomedicine as a treatment for cardiovascular disease and malaria, has the potential to treat hypertension, according to a study published in BMC Complementary and Alternative Medicine.
